Amber James (She/Her)

Clinical Psychology PsyD | Fresno Campus

Hometown: Birmingham, AL

Amber is a dedicated and compassionate mental health professional, advocate, mother, wife, friend, and student. She is pursuing a PsyD in Clinical Psychology at the California School of Professional Psychology at Alliant International University in Fresno. Amber is committed to social justice, mental health equity, and holistic care, which is evident in her volunteerism, leadership, and professional affiliations. She is a member of SGA-Fresno and Fresno Global Initiative. She is also a student member of the American Psychological Association, the Association of Black Psychologists (ABPsi), American Counseling Association, and California Psychological Association (CPA). Amber serves on the Student Boards for ABPsi and CPA. She is also a member of Junior League of Fresno. Research Interests: Trauma, Addiction, Spirituality

Favorite part of the program: My favorite part of my program is the experiential components early on and support to explore my interests.

Practicum/Internship site: GPE Grant - Valley Health Team

Advice to first year students: Build a community with a cohort and identify a mentor within an advanced student or professor.
